How they compare
Fiji currently reports 0.0681 under-five deaths per woman against 0.067 under-five deaths per woman in Tuvalu, a difference of 0.0011 under-five deaths per woman.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 68 shared years of data; in 1954 it was Tuvalu ahead.
Fiji ranks 62nd and Tuvalu ranks 64th of 200 countries.
Across the 8 decades both report, Fiji averaged higher in 1 and Tuvalu in 7.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Fiji | Tuvalu |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1950s | 0.6436 under-five deaths per woman | 1.02 under-five deaths per woman | 0.3744 under-five deaths per woman | Tuvalu |
| 1960s | 0.3791 under-five deaths per woman | 0.6514 under-five deaths per woman | 0.2723 under-five deaths per woman | Tuvalu |
| 1970s | 0.224 under-five deaths per woman | 0.3174 under-five deaths per woman | 0.0934 under-five deaths per woman | Tuvalu |
| 1980s | 0.1352 under-five deaths per woman | 0.2254 under-five deaths per woman | 0.0903 under-five deaths per woman | Tuvalu |
| 1990s | 0.0824 under-five deaths per woman | 0.1982 under-five deaths per woman | 0.1158 under-five deaths per woman | Tuvalu |
| 2000s | 0.0673 under-five deaths per woman | 0.1397 under-five deaths per woman | 0.0725 under-five deaths per woman | Tuvalu |
| 2010s | 0.058 under-five deaths per woman | 0.0887 under-five deaths per woman | 0.0307 under-five deaths per woman | Tuvalu |
| 2020s | 0.069 under-five deaths per woman | 0.0684 under-five deaths per woman | 0.0006 under-five deaths per woman | Fiji |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.

About this data
Fertility rate (average number of children per woman) multiplied by the under-five mortality rate (probability of dying before age five).
